Phish Bowl Alerts
Be aware of a fraudulent email posing as a "BrownAlert" from a non-Brown email domain. The message contains several red flags - it originates from a spoofed Virginia.edu address, utilizes inconsistent branding, has unusual grammar, and contains formatting errors. The call to action, "Release these messages," is a common phishing tactic designed to provoke an immediate reaction. Remember, always verify that official communication has either come directly from Brown or via a service affiliated with Brown, that it features consistent formatting, and is free from obvious grammatical errors. Always verify suspicious emails before taking any action and report them to phishbowl@brown.edu.
